Всем привет.
Для заполнения одной мутной формы понадобились серийные и заводские номера сервера как устройства. Разумеется это связано больше с бухгалтерским учетом чем с работой Администратора, ибо мне, например, такие номера совершенно в работе не нужны. Тем более что эти номера всегда есть на корпусе устройства.
Но как оказалось, нет особой необходимости осматривать с фонариком сервер если у тебя есть доступ к ОС самого сервера.
Если сервер выключен, то его надо либо удаленно включить, например через iLO, либо протопать ножками и включить кнопкой питания. В этом случае серийные и заводские номера могут быть найдены в BIOS сервера.
Но если сервер доступен удаленно то серийные и заводские номера получаем запросом Powershell:
# Serial number
Get-WmiObject win32_bios | select Serialnumber
# Product number
Get-WmiObject win32_computersystem | Select-Object SystemSKUNumber
Либо запросом WMI:
# Serial number
wmic bios get SerialNumber
# Product number
wmic computersystem get SystemSKUNumber
Увы, а вот инвентарный номер внутри системы не значится. И визуально лепят его куда не попадя.(
Удачи.
# Узнать производителя
ReplyDeleteGet-WmiObject -Class Win32_ComputerSystem | Select-Object -ExpandProperty Manufacturer
wmic csproduct get vendor
# Узнать модель
Get-WmiObject -Class Win32_ComputerSystem | Select-Object -ExpandProperty Model
wmic csproduct get name
Я бы не доверял SystemSKUNumber, много раз видел его затертым всякой чепухой.
ReplyDelete